Lighting Setup

I took some photos of my Grandson Landon today using the photo equipment I got. Here are some of the photos I took along with the lighting setup I used. The camera I used was a Canon T2i with a Canon EF-S 18-55mm f/3.5-5.6 IS II lens.
Here is the setup. The bulbs are fluorescent balanced for daylight.

Mode: Portrait; ISO: 400; Shutter; 1/60; F-Stop: 5.6; Built in flash - on.
Mode: Portrait; ISO: 400; Shutter; 1/60; F-Stop: 5.6; Built in flash - on.
Mode: AE; ISO: 400; Shutter; 1/60; F-Stop: 5.6; Built in flash - on.
Mode: AE; ISO: 400; Shutter; 1/60; F-Stop: 5.6; Built in flash - off. Note the light coming thru the backdrop.
Mode: AE; ISO: 400; Shutter; 1/60; F-Stop: 5.6; Built in flash - off. I added a black sheet over the background to block the light.
Mode: AE; ISO: 400; Shutter; 1/30; F-Stop: 54.5; Built in flash - off.
Mode: AE; ISO: 400; Shutter; 1/30; F-Stop: 5.6; Built in flash - off.
Mode: AE; ISO: 800; Shutter; 1/30; F-Stop: 5.6; Built in flash - off.
As you can see I need to practice more. I would have taken more but my subject was getting restless.
